Integrating a PIN diode and a transimpedance amplifier, the AMT121302T46F device answers the call for a front end in 1300-nm fiber optic installations for Gigabit networks. The device offers high sensitivity and impressive overload performance, it's claimed, giving it the robustness to support current and emerging data communication systems, such as Gigabit Ethernet and Fibre Channel. The PIN-TIA device's high sensitivity allows increased signal transmission distances and improved reliability. Typical sensitivity is -25 dBm and gain is 2600V/W or more. The unit comes in a TO-46 flat windowed package and requires a 5V supply at 35 mA typical.

Company: ANADIGICS INC.
